Janda is a Rural village located in Mahulpalli, Sambalpur, Odisha.

The total population of Janda is 462.

Janda village comprises 118 households.

The literacy rate in Janda is 55.7%. Among the literate population of 231, there are 138 literate males and 93 literate females.

In Janda, there are 220 males and 242 females, with a sex ratio of 1100 females per 1000 males.

There are 47 children (10.2% of population), comprising 23 boys and 24 girls.

The total number of workers in Janda is 314, with 201 main workers and 113 marginal workers.

In Janda, there are 33 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(18 males, 15 females) and 341 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(158 males, 183 females).

Janda is located in Odisha state, Sambalpur district, and falls under Mahulpalli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 381472 and LGD code is 381472.
